Brachypelma vagans, or Mexican Red Rump Tarantulas, are a well-liked species among tarantula fans because of their eye-catching appearance, manageable size, and generally calm disposition. They are a terrestrial species that are native to Central America, especially Mexico. They do well in a variety of environments, including as grasslands, scrublands, and tropical rainforests. Outward Look The unusual coloring of the Mexican Red Rump Tarantula is well known. Its smooth, black hair covers much of its body, including its legs and carapace, and stands in dramatic contrast to the vivid red hairs on its abdomen. As a defensive tactic to agitate any predators, these crimson hairs have the ability to be flicked off. Dimensions and Duration Male leg spans are slightly smaller, averaging approximately 4 to 5 inches, whereas adult female leg spans commonly reach about 5 to 6 inches. Males typically only live for six to eight years in captivity, but females can live up to 20 years in this situation. The sexes' distinct reproductive roles and life choices account for this notable disparity in longevity. Natural Environment and Behavior Mexican Red Rump Tarantulas are prolific burrowers who spend a large amount of their time in the earth excavating large burrows. They can be protected from harsh weather and predators by their burrows. Their primary mode of survival is nocturnal, since they come out at night to hunt small rodents, insects, and other invertebrates. Characteristics Mexican Red Rump Tarantulas are good for beginning tarantula keepers because they are generally thought to be gentle and tolerant of handling. Individual temperaments, however, can differ, and some may exhibit more protective actions when frightened, like lifting their front legs or flicking itching hairs. In order to reduce tension, handlers should respect these signals and respond to them softly and sparingly. Relevance to the Pet Industry Because of its appealing look, minimal maintenance requirements, and manageable size, this species has become a mainstay in the pet trade. Successful captive breeding initiatives have helped to improve the health and adaptability of specimens for enthusiasts while also lessening the strain on wild populations. Status of Conservation The Mexican Red Rump Tarantula is not officially classified as endangered, although habitat degradation and over-collection in some regions are risks to the species. To ensure their continued existence in the wild, responsible pet ownership and support for captive breeding initiatives are essential.
